Dragon Slayer is just flavour text. It is sometimes given to weapons that do silver damage as Dragons are extremely vulnerable to silver(x4). However, weapons that have the Bane attribute do double damage against the named monster which stacks with other multipliers. So a Dragon Bane weapon would do double damage, and a Silver Bragon Bane weapon would do x8 damage. And look out for the Vorpel Blade, that will really help against dragons.
A couple of the visual effects appear slightly before the shot hits, poison as you've seen, stun, and a couple of others. I should fix that, but it wasn't too high on my list.
In They Dwell Beneath you're meant to be rising up through the mountain. I suppose I should have made that clearer in the quest blurb. I'll take a look at improving the quest text.
A few people have commented that the scabbard looks like a crossbow. That's down to my crappy pixelling skills. Sorry.
